Description

A brand new Spot story!Eric Hill's famous puppy Spot just loves sport!Spot Loves Sport is a delightful storybook to share with busy toddlers, and is full of games they will recognise. Follow Spot on his adventure as he enjoys playing football, tennis, baseball and basketball, as well as having a race and riding his bike with his best friends Helen, Steve and Tom.The perfect book to share with young children during playtime!

About the Author

Eric Hill (1927-2014) started his artistic career as an art studio messenger and from there went on to become a cartoonist and eventually an art director at a leading advertising agency. In 1978 Eric made up a story about a small puppy to read to his son at bedtime and Spot was born. The success of his first bestselling lift-the-flap classic Where's Spot? in 1980 convinced him to become a full-time author, and his Spot books have been enjoyed by children around the world ever since. In 2008 he was awarded an OBE for services to children's literacy.
